Job overview

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N) - Long Term Care (LTC) in Petersburg, ND. This is an onsite position with a salary range of $26.00 - $36.00 per hour. Good Samaritan is a not-for-profit organization with over 100 years of service to seniors. This role provides professional nursing care for residents of all ages in long term care, under the supervision of a registered nurse, advanced practice provider, or physician. Responsibilities include assessing residents, administering medications, and contributing to care plans.

What you'll do

  • Provides professional nursing care for residents of all ages in long term care, under the supervision of a registered nurse, advanced practice provider, or physician.
  • Demonstrates knowledge of nursing principles.
  • Demonstrates competency and practices within the full scope of nursing expertise/knowledge.
  • Utilizes appropriate age and population specific standards related to the physical and psychosocial needs of the resident as per care plan.
  • Performs testing to evaluate data reflective of the resident's status.
  • Recognizes problems, recommends solutions and responds effectively to assist in an emergent situation.
  • Ensures the health, comfort and safety of residents.
  • Contributes to the assessment of residents and administers medications or treatments as ordered.
  • Provides technical support to healthcare professionals.
  • Documents resident interactions and outcomes.
  • Establishes and maintains effective working relationships with residents, healthcare providers, and the public.
  • Works effectively with professional and supportive personnel.
  • Communicates clearly and maintains confidentiality.
  • Counsels residents, family members and/or resident advocate.
  • Knowledge of resident education principles.
  • Performs other related duties as assigned.
